Answer:
A) slope = 20.
B) The slope of 20 dollars per hour means that for every hour, the price of the service call increases by 20 dollars (or you could say the price of the service call is 20 dollars every hour, both work.)
Step-by-step explanation:
Recall that slope is y2 - y1 / x2 - x1.
Excellent. We are provided with two points: (1, 60) and (3, 100). Let’s enter this into our formula.
Slope = (100 - 60) / (3 - 1) = 40 / 2 = 20.
Now, to determine what the slope means, we can look at the axis titles on the graph. The x axis title is hours, or time in hours. The y axis title is price of the service call in dollars. Therefore, the slope is price (in dollars) per time (in hours).
This can be restated as: The slope of 20 dollars per hour means that for every hour, the price of the service call increases by 20 dollars (or you could say the price of the service call is 20 dollars every hour, both work.)

answer:
423.5
step1.
you find the value of 3% by dividing over 100 because percentage is over 100 so 3/100
step2
multiply by $350
so 3/100×350=10.5
step3
we are told the investment is for 7years so we multiply 10.5 by 7 because 10.5 is only for 1year
10.5×7=73.5
step4
add the 73.5 to the 350 then you have your answer
